But nevertheless, I must transition onto the wireless bluetooth category. So for my first experience I went with a pair of Willful T1 Earbuds. These headphones look similar to Galaxy earbuds which was the selling point for me aside from the under $40 pricetag. Upon opening them I will say the look pretty nice! The case doesn’t look or feel cheap and the earbuds themselves look pretty nice. That is where the “positives” started to end for me sadly. I find myself struggling a little bit to take them out of the case. If I were standing up trying to remove them I might be a little scared of mishandling them and dropping them. The case contains magnet to help them sit firmly in position which makes removing them a little difficult. But placing them back into the case for charging is very simple due to the magnets. When it comes to actually using them I also am not as happy as I thought I’d be. They sit a little loose in my ears. They are actually pretty sturdy as shaking my head or walking I found them not falling out at all. But they still felt little loose as if they should have been closer to my ears to maybe provide more sound.
As far as music quality I tend to be a bass-heavy person as a fan of EDM music. In that category I find these headphones lacking. If your looking for something that bumps like your at a DJ concert, these ARE NOT THEM! Maybe i’m asking for too much in the under $40-50 range of wireless earbuds. Listening to other genres again the experience just left me wanting more. More bass, more vocals, more natural sound and more overall volume! But earbuds are not just for music you may say, so hows the call quality? Much like the rest of this review, the call quality so far is not great. I haven’t had any issues with calls connecting and people hearing me which is great, but on my end hearing them the volume is a little quiet. Alone its easy to hear them but out in a crowd I think it would be fairly difficult to fully have a conversation.
On a positive note, I will say I have found on first use is the pairing has been easy and quick! Just take them out of the case and man do they connect fast! Also the controls on them are very nice! The controls for these earbuds are as follows:
Left earbud:
Press once: Play/Pause Answer/Hang-up
Press twice: Play previous song (Refuse to answer the call)
Press three times: volume down
Right earbud:
Press once: Play/Pause Answer/Hang-up
Press twice: Play next song (Refuse to answer the call)
Press three times: volume up
After reading those instructions I initially thought it may be difficult trying to remember which side performs which function, but upon use I find them working really well without fail.
So in closing upon first use of the Willful T1 earbuds I would say that I don’t find them to be worth the $35 price tag. Even though they are relatively cheap, and are true wireless, they just don’t offer enough positives for the $35 price. At least if your main priority is music over calls. If your looking for a pair of earbuds to use mainly for calls and maybe lite music listening then for now I’d say for $35 they may be worth a try if your nervous about spending more.
